An Irule for Client Ssl Profile that Allows Unassigned TLS Extension Values (17516)
As brilliant as this is.Is it possible that post-quantum cryptography may be a stumbling block to this solution, by causing tcp fragmentation. With Clienthello packets of 540bytes, this worked perfectly. An example is the "Extension Unknown Type 17516" added there.
Recent tests show the extension addition is no longer working. The only significant change is that CLIENTSSL HELLO packets are now fragmented on TLS 1.3 with the Post-Quantum Cryptography implementation on clients (browsers), with CLIENTSSL HELLO now regularly abover 1500 bytes causing fragmentation.
is it possible if F5 is Client-side server to force all clients to use X25519 ciphers instead of X25519Kyber512Draft00 and X25519Kyber768 X25519MLKEM768 to ensure that full flow is not broken. is there any changes on CLIENTSSL Profile to implement this.
